
JS网页特效:下雪及自定义图片(如樱花、花瓣)
5星
- 浏览量: 0
- 大小:None
- 文件类型:ZIP
简介:
本教程介绍如何在JavaScript网页中实现唯美的下雪效果,并提供自定义动画图像的功能,例如添加樱花或花瓣飘落,增添页面互动性和视觉美感。
在网页设计中,动态特效是提升用户体验和视觉吸引力的重要手段之一。“js网页特效:下雪、可自定义图片,可以改为樱花、花瓣”项目提供了丰富的交互式元素,使得网页背景能够呈现出雪花飘落、樱花飞舞或者花瓣纷飞的效果。这种特效能为用户营造出浪漫生动的氛围,尤其适用于节日或特定主题的网页设计。
这个项目的重点在于使用JavaScript(JS)编程语言实现动态效果。通过编写JavaScript代码,可以创建一个循环来模拟粒子(如雪花、樱花或花瓣)从上至下的运动轨迹,并形成下雪或者飘落的效果。
关键知识点包括:
1. **粒子系统**:这是特效的基础,每个粒子都有自己的位置、速度和透明度等属性。更新这些属性能够模拟出粒子的动态效果。
2. **自定义参数**:用户可以根据需求调整速度、透明度和角度来改变视觉效果。
3. **CSS(层叠样式表)**:用于设置粒子的大小、颜色及阴影效果,以增强整体视觉表现。
4. **HTML(超文本标记语言)**:“index.html”文件是网页的基础结构,并且包含了JavaScript代码引用以及容器元素,用来显示特效。
5. **事件监听器**:通过使用JavaScript中的事件监听机制来响应用户操作如改变速度或切换不同类型的粒子效果。
6. **图片资源**:项目可能包含用于模拟雪花、樱花或花瓣的图像文件。这些图片可以通过JavaScript动态加载并应用到粒子上。
7. **LICENSE.txt** 文件提供了关于如何合法使用和分发该特效代码的信息。
8. **README.txt** 通常包含了项目的安装指南,包括配置说明以及运行方法等信息。
这个项目展示了通过结合HTML、CSS与JavaScript可以创造出多种创意且具有视觉冲击力的网页动态效果。对于开发者而言,研究并理解该项目能够帮助他们掌握实现此类特效的方法,并提升前端开发技能;而对于非技术背景的人来说,则有助于更好地欣赏和理解现代网页设计中的复杂性和美感。
全部评论 (0)


